The USC School of Architecture launched the Homeless Studio, where 11 fourth year students are rethinking homeless architecture, building temporary, moveable, modular and expandable structures. Students will deliver their finished structures to homeless people around the city.

A modest, 92-square-feet structure designed by fourth-year USC architecture students could become key to temporarily easing homelessness until people find permanent housing. It’s easy to assemble and easy to remove, which could ease the permitting process.
